The Essentials of Surety Bonds



If you're unfamiliar with Surety bonds, it is essential to understand the basics of just how they work. a Surety bond is a three-party agreement between the principal (the party that requires the bond), the obligee (the event who needs the bond), and the Surety (the celebration providing the bond).

The purpose of a Surety bond is to make sure that the major fulfills their obligations as specified in the bond contract. Simply put, it ensures that the principal will certainly complete a project or satisfy a contract efficiently.

If the primary stops working to fulfill their responsibilities, the obligee can make a case versus the bond, and the Surety will certainly step in to compensate the obligee. Comprehending the Function of the Surety



The Surety plays a crucial duty in the process of obtaining and preserving a Surety bond. Comprehending their duty is vital to navigating the globe of Surety bonds properly.

- ** Financial Responsibility **: The Surety is accountable for making sure that the bond principal fulfills their responsibilities as detailed in the bond agreement.

- ** Risk Evaluation **: Prior to providing a bond, the Surety carefully analyzes the principal's economic security, record, and ability to satisfy their commitments.

- ** Claims Handling **: In the event of a bond insurance claim, the Surety checks out the case and determines its legitimacy. If the case is legitimate, the Surety compensates the injured party approximately the bond amount.

- ** Indemnification **: The principal is needed to indemnify the Surety for any type of losses sustained because of their activities or failing to meet their responsibilities.
